The Mental Laundry Cycle: Sort, Mend, and Air Out Repeating Thoughts
When the same thoughts keep returning they feel like damp clothes clinging to your shoulders. In this calm, five‑minute monologue Isabella invites listeners to imagine their mind as a laundry routine. Rather than wearing every thought immediately, you sort: quick wash (act now), mend (reframe or repair a helpful piece), or air‑dry (let the rest sit and breathe). Grounded in everyday scenes—waking with replaying comments, fretting before a meeting, or scrolling while half‑distracted—this episode teaches a three‑step, time‑friendly practice to sort one mental load in under four minutes.
